The thought of setting 4/0 hooks into galvanized buckets with a fly line that wouldn't act like a bungy cord has always appealed - the reality was even better than we had hoped.
Combining Power Core with our Ridge coatings didn't disappoint, a fly line that casts like a bomb with hooking power that quickly puts you in control, Ridges in the coating reduce 'hi-speed tangles' - the ridged surface easily sliding over itself as the running line whipped up from the deck.
With a balanced taper, the Airflo Super Dri Tarpon Fly Line has been designed to hugely increase technical delivery, even your largest of flies will go exactly where you want it, with ease.
Additional Information
Product Use: Tarpon and larger saltwater species in tropical conditions
Line Size: WF10-12
Color: Float - Sandy Tan / Grey , Intermediate - Clear Blue
Density: Float, Intermediate (1.5IPS)
Core Material: Low Stretch (6%) Braided Power Core
Coating: Tropical Polyurethane (PU)
Loop Type: Micro Loop Both Ends
Optimum Temperature Range: 68F to 100.4F
